Output 8e2460fdc33f66ed1a33409f1e9371ca62b6bfd267c7bfdb44819a14d82eb5c1:0

value
1580813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f107056f67c4933545aa5f912fb81e6bc4d64e8 OP_EQUAL
address
38u4ztTkBFREjCDmTVUMHi1nvCz6iVdVnF
transaction
8e2460fdc33f66ed1a33409f1e9371ca62b6bfd267c7bfdb44819a14d82eb5c1
spent
true